The state deputy (-SP) sent a representation to the São Paulo Attorney General, in which he states that the government (Republicans) committed acts of administrative improbity in the management of education in the state.
According to Donato, the state administration calculated expenses with inactive people to reach the limit of tax revenue, which is prohibited by the Constitution.
This would have occurred in 2021, 2022 and 2023, that is, in the administrations of , and Tarcísio. Last year, the amount improperly used to pay pensions and retirements would have been R$33 billion, according to Donato.
In 2024, the parliamentarian projects, the value will reach R$15 billion, if the government repeats the practice.
“The recurrence of the accounting of inactive people in the expenses computed on education and the lack of compensation for deviations made in previous years indicate that the current head of the Executive Branch, Tarcísio de Freitas, maintains a clear intention to disguise the accounting of the state’s finances”, he states representation.
The PT member asks the prosecutor to present actions so that Tarcísio returns the amounts allocated to the payment of retirements and pensions in recent years to the education budget and for the governor to be held accountable for acts of administrative improbity.
He also asks the prosecutor to file criminal charges against the governor for irregular use of public funds.
Alesp (Legislative Assembly of the State of ) approved in a second and definitive vote on Wednesday (27) a PEC (Proposed Amendment to the Constitution) of the government of São Paulo that allows.
The proposal modifies the 1989 Constitution of São Paulo, which determines the expenditure of 30% of tax revenue on . The change reduces this obligation to 25% starting next year. The difference, of five percentage points, could be allocated to shares.
